66066155915881 has 9 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 72618269654973. Its totient is φ = 60060060460620.
The previous prime is 66066155915777. The next prime is 66066155915899. The reversal of 66066155915881 is 18851955166066.
The square root of 66066155915881 is 8128109.
It is a perfect power (a square), and thus also a powerful number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 66066155915881 - 235 = 66031796177513 is a prime.
It is a super-2 number, since 2×660661559158812 (a number of 28 digits) contains 22 as substring.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(66066155975881)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 8 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 89039740 + ... + 89778658.
Almost surely, 266066155915881 is an apocalyptic number.
66066155915881 is the 8128109-th square number.
66066155915881 is the 4064055-th centered octagonal number.
It is an amenable number.
66066155915881 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(6552113739092).
66066155915881 is an frugal number, since it uses more digits than its factorization.
66066155915881 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 1477860 (or 738930 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 93312000, while the sum is 67.
The spelling of 66066155915881 in words is "sixty-six trillion, sixty-six billion, one hundred fifty-five million, nine hundred fifteen thousand, eight hundred eighty-one".
